Hewson takes on the role of Flora, a young woman who was a teen mom and is now struggling with how to connect with her “rebellious teenage son Max,” per the synopsis.
When he gets caught by law enforcement, the police encourages Flora to find her son a hobby. And she might have found the answer through an old acoustic guitar. With the help of “washed-up LA musician” Jeff, perhaps mother and son will find out just how powerful music can be, and how it can help bring them closer.

Unfortunately, Flora and Son is not streaming on Netflix. The film first debuted at the 2023 Sundance Film Festival in January. On Sept. 22, 2023, the productionwas released theatrically. At this time, the movie is only available to watch on the big screens.
While it’s in theaters now, the musical comedy-drama will begin streaming on Apple TV+ Friday, Sept. 29, 2023. A monthly subscription to the service costs $6.99/month.
Eve Hewson’s character is at the center of the story, and you may recognize the actress from a couple of projects. First is psychological thriller series Behind Her Eyes on Netflix. Another is Bad Sisters which is also an Apple Studios production. Hewson starred alongside Sharon Horgan.
